Fascinating two-volume lot dedicated to one of the most celebrated works of Italian ornithology from the Seicento: the Vccelliera by Giovanni Pietro Olina, published in Rome in 1622. Richly illustrated and set within the lively cultural milieu of the early Accademia dei Lincei, the work represents one of the most important treatises on nature, the breeding, and the capture of birds.

The present lot reproduces in full the original 1622 edition and accompanies it with the fundamental study by Francesco Solinas, devoted to the genesis of the work and to the historical and cultural context of Baroque Rome.

The two volumes constitute the first two numbers of the famous and esteemed series "Rariora et Mirabilia", published by the publishing house Olschki.
